Car batteries serve as compact electrical storage units for your vehicle. They convert chemical energy to usable electrical energy to supply the electrical needs of your car. Car battery technology hasn’t changed much in the last 70 years. These crucial car components have a lead-acid design, wherein electrolyte or acid reacts with interior lead plates in order to produce electricity. Naturally, it takes more energy to power a bigger engine than a smaller one, so the first thing you should remember when going to an automotive service shop for possible battery replacement is to look for car batteries that are rated and sized accordingly.
Newer car models have more electrical demands than older ones. This is due to the addition of computers, accessories, and modules that require more power to operate. This is another important factor to consider when looking for a car battery replacement service. In addition to a properly sized and rated car battery, you want a unit that is powerful enough to supply the electrical load that additional systems require in order to work properly. When a battery is too small, you risk overworking its mechanisms to meet the power demands of the vehicle, causing the battery to fail prematurely. This will also mean more frequent replacements.
